An option is a contract that gives its owner the right — but not the obligation — to buy or sell an underlying asset. An option’s value depends on the price of the underlying security (e.g., a stock). An options contract might allow its owner to buy 100 shares of an underlying asset (that would be a “call”), or might allow its owner ...

Tourists, businesses, and governments ... adp pricewilmar Robinhood offers stocks, ETFs, options, and cryptocurrency trading. Mutual funds, fixed income, closed end funds, and preferred stocks aren’t supported, nor is futures trading. Robinhood has limited support for OTC stocks.
